Today is the deadline for Kentuckians and Illinoisans who need to register to vote in November’s presidential election. Mail-in registrations in Kentucky must be postmarked by today to be accepted. Voters who’ve moved since the last election should update their registration today as well. Those who have moved to a different county who don’t update their registration won’t be permitted to vote. To register in Illinois, voters must have lived in their precinct for at least 30 days before the election.
